Output 59e89dc0a26e38ecaec3f1da8c74f7dda1238bd795329ba7912e51ef0128575b:3

value
15959417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44c1d8fe235c472cc8cf83d13ad7dceed58e5538 OP_EQUAL
address
37xa6MgyfxGFgp3krYT9d5jiLcEqBM5tCq
transaction
59e89dc0a26e38ecaec3f1da8c74f7dda1238bd795329ba7912e51ef0128575b
spent
true